Bringing humor to the masses, Chris Clements, born in 1971 in Canada, has been actively directing impactful animated series since the 1990s. Known mainly for his work in the comedy genre, Clements has made a name for himself with the globally successful series like "The Simpsons" and "Family Guy," though he hasn't snagged any major film festival awards yet. His authorial style often features a blend of slapstick humor, witty dialogue and pop culture references, making his work both entertaining and relatable.
